What Affects Garage Door Repair Costs in Marcell?
Understanding pricing factors helps you budget accurately and avoid surprises
labor costs
Marcell is in rural Itasca County, where garage door technicians often travel from larger towns like Grand Rapids or Bemidji. Travel time and mileage can factor into service call fees, which typically range from a standard trip charge to higher amounts for longer drives. Fewer local specialists also mean demand can outpace supply, keeping labor rates steady.
market dynamics
Garage door repair is a niche trade, and Marcell has a limited number of qualified technicians nearby. This lower competition can mean less price variability between providers, but it also makes scheduling flexibility important. Most professionals serve a wide area, so you may be quoted based on their availability and your location relative to their base of operations.
seasonal trends
Minnesota winters are harsh, and cold weather often causes spring failures, frozen cables, and brittle components. Spring and fall tend to be the busiest seasons for repairs. You may experience longer wait times or higher demand pricing during peak thaw months and before winter sets in.
🧱 Key Pricing Components
- ✓ Service call fee – A flat charge for the technician to arrive and diagnose the issue, often covering the first 30 minutes on-site.
- ✓ Parts and materials – Cost of replacement springs, cables, rollers, openers, sensors, or tracks. Premium or heavy-duty parts cost more but often last longer.
- ✓ Labor by the job – Most garage door repairs are quoted as a flat rate for the entire job, not by the hour, so you know the total before work begins.
- ✓ Emergency or after-hours surcharges – If your repair can't wait until normal business hours, expect an additional fee for evenings, weekends, or holidays.
- ✓ Tension spring handling – Springs are under high tension and dangerous to work with. Repairs involving torsion or extension springs carry specialized labor costs due to the skill and risk involved.
- ✓ Opener programming and electrical work – If your repair involves wiring, sensor alignment, or smart opener setup, there may be additional charges for programming or electrical diagnostics.

How to Save Money on Garage Door Repair
Smart strategies to get quality service without overpaying
Tip
Ask for an itemized written estimate that separates parts, labor, and service fees before any work starts.
Tip
Get at least two quotes from different local providers to gauge fair market pricing for your specific repair.
Tip
Confirm whether the quote includes travel or mileage fees — especially important in rural Itasca County where distances add up.
Tip
Ask about warranties on parts and labor — reputable pros stand behind their work for at least 30 to 90 days.
Tip
Clarify if the quoted price is a flat rate or if there's potential for additional charges if unexpected issues are found during the repair.
Tip
Check online reviews and ask for proof of insurance and licensing before hiring anyone to work on your property.
Pricing Red Flags
Warning Sign
Prices that seem too good to be true — Extremely low quotes often lead to upselling once the technician is on-site or use of substandard parts.
Warning Sign
High-pressure tactics or same-day discount ultimatums — Legitimate professionals give you time to review the quote and decide without pressure.
Warning Sign
Demanding full payment upfront — Reputable garage door companies typically collect payment after the work is completed to your satisfaction.
Warning Sign
Vague verbal estimates with no written contract — Always get a detailed written estimate before any work begins to avoid surprise charges.
Warning Sign
Refusal to show proof of insurance — If a technician is injured on your property, you could be held liable if they're uninsured.

💬 How much does a garage door spring replacement cost in Marcell?
Spring replacement is one of the most common garage door repairs. The cost depends on the type of spring (torsion vs. extension), the door size, and the technician's labor rate. Torsion springs typically cost more than extension springs. A professional can give you an exact quote after inspecting your setup.
💬 Do I need a permit for garage door repair in Itasca County?
Minor repairs and part replacements typically do not require a permit. However, if you're replacing the entire door, opener, or making structural changes, local building codes may apply. It's best to ask your contractor what permits are needed for your specific project.
💬 Why is my garage door making a loud noise when opening or closing?
Loud noises often indicate worn rollers, loose hardware, or lack of lubrication on moving parts. In some cases, it can signal a more serious issue like a failing opener motor or unbalanced springs. A technician can diagnose the source during a service call and quote the repair.
💬 Can I repair a garage door spring myself to save money?
Garage door springs are under extreme tension and can cause serious injury or death if mishandled. Professional repair is strongly recommended for spring work. The cost of a professional replacement is far less than a trip to the emergency room.
💬 How long does a typical garage door repair take?
Most standard repairs like spring replacements, cable fixes, or opener adjustments take 1 to 3 hours on-site. More complex jobs like full track realignment or opener installation may take longer. Your technician should give you a time estimate in the quote.
💬 What should I do if my garage door won't open in freezing weather?
Cold temperatures can cause lubrication to thicken, metal parts to contract, and sensors to misalign. Try clearing ice from the tracks and check that the sensor lenses are clean. If the door still won't open, call a professional — forcing it can cause further damage.
